@font-face {font-family:"TitleFont";src:url("/fonts/title.woff2") format("woff2");font-weight:400;font-style:normal;font-display:block}.noselect{-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}#search_field form{display:grid;grid-template-rows:1fr;grid-template-columns:1fr 48px;margin-bottom:1rem}#search-text{color:var(--foreground);background-color:rgba(255,255,255,.06);margin:0;padding:0;border:none;padding-left:calc(1rem + 3px);padding-top:.5rem;padding-bottom:.5rem;outline:none;font-size:13pt;font-family:MainFont}#search-submit{background-color:rgba(255,255,255,.06);border:none;display:flex;flex-direction:row;justify-content:center;align-items:center}#search-submit:hover {cursor:pointer}#container{width:100%;min-height:100%;display:grid;grid-template-rows:1fr;grid-template-columns:2em 1fr 2em}#item{grid-column:2;overflow-x:hidden;overflow-y:hidden}#title{text-align:center;margin:3rem 0 3rem 0}#title h1{font-family:TitleFont;font-size:50pt;letter-spacing:-1px;margin:0}.post-entry{border-left:3px solid var(--foreground);padding-left:1rem;margin-bottom:1rem}.post-title{font-size:16pt;margin-bottom:.25rem}.post-metadata{line-height:1.5em}.post-metadata,.post-metadata span,.post-metadata span *{font-size:13pt}.post-metadata span{color:var(--cite);margin-right:.5rem}.post-metadata .post-date{margin-right:1rem}.post-date::after {content:"\A";white-space:pre}a:hover {animation:make-link .5s ease;animation-fill-mode:forwards}@media (min-width: 800px){#container{grid-template-columns:1fr 680px 1fr}.post-date::after {content:"";white-space:normal}.post-metadata{line-height:1.15em}}